Hi.
My wife has been diagnosed with MND. She has been a keen amateur photographer and where we live , in the country there are many photo opportunities. We have a well populated bird table and frequent visits from Deer, Pheasant and other wildlife. As her condition deteriorates, it has become impossible for her to venture outside with her camera, so I was hoping to get her a zoom lense PTZ type camera. Something she could control from her iPad and capture small video clips and still photos. She would like to be able to do this from inside. Our internet is not to bad, about 10 mb. As you can tell I have very limited knowledge and was hoping to tap in to your collective knowledge base.
I would like to spend , if poss, less than £150.
Any help would be greatly appreciated.
Terry and Theresa

Welcome @Tel999

Sorry to hear about your wife's condition ..

Perhaps Andy EmpireTecAndy here has a 2MP PTZ that would work for you .. a proper PTZ outdoor rated camera probably will run you a bit more than your budget ..

Amcrest had some 2MP PT indoor cameras which many also liked that were affordable ..

Here's the wifi version of the Amcrest camera that many liked for indoors / patio ..
